Jurisdiction:

Sec. 20. JUDICIARY AND CIVIL JURISPRUDENCE. The commission
shall have nine members, with jurisdiction over all matters
pertaining to:
(1) fines and penalties arising under civil laws;
(two) civil police, including rights, duties, remedies, and
procedures thereunder, and including probate and guardianship
matters;
(3) ceremonious process in the courts of Texas;
(4) administrative law and the adjudication of rights
past administrative agencies;
(v) permission to sue the country;
(vi) uniform state laws;
(7) creating, irresolute, or otherwise affecting courts
of judicial districts of the country;
(8) establishing districts for the election of
judicial officers;
(9) courts and court procedures except where
jurisdiction is specifically granted to some other continuing
committee; and
(10) the following land agencies: the Supreme Court,
the courts of appeals, the Court of Criminal Appeals, the State
Committee on Judicial Deport, the Role of Court Administration
of the Texas Judicial Organisation, the State Law Library, the Texas
Judicial Council, the Judicial Branch Certification Commission,
the Office of the Attorney General, the Board of Law Examiners, the
Country Bar of Texas, and the State Function of Authoritative
Hearings.
